WebJun 8, 2024 · Radical acceptance is a distress tolerance skill that is designed to keep pain from turning into suffering. While pain is part of life, radical acceptance allows us to keep that pain from becoming suffering. By accepting the facts of reality without responding by throwing a tantrum or with willful negligence. In other words, it is what it is . WebDialectical behavior therapy includes a form of decisional balance sheet called a pros and cons grid. [24] Kickstarter co-founder Yancey Strickler created a four-cell matrix similar in appearance to a decisional balance sheet that he compared to a bento box, with cells for self and others, present and future. [25] ABC model [ edit] WebSep 14, 2024 · Pros and Cons can function as a beneficial distress tolerance skill in DBT. As with other distress tolerance skills, Pros and Cons are often used in crisis situations. It can aid in helping us avoid acting impulsively while weighing the pros and cons of the impulsive decision at hand. Instead
